Nettet18. okt. 2016 · Landfill gases can also move underground, potentially causing fires and explosions, and the liquid or leachate that accumulates in landfills can contaminate groundwater. Moreover, landfills are unsightly and odorous. A landfill in Danbury, Conn. Photo: United Nations.
